C# 클래스 TuneBlaster_.BallManager

The class in charge of creating all the balls in the regular game mode Author Hugh Corrigan, Ahmed Warreth, Dermot Kirby
파일 보기 프로젝트 열기: kiniry-teaching/UCD 1 사용 예제들

공개 프로퍼티들

프로퍼티 타입 설명
green Microsoft.Xna.Framework.Graphics.Texture2D

공개 메소드들

메소드 설명
BallManager ( Core c ) : System
BallManager ( Core c, Microsoft.Xna.Framework.Game g ) : System
BallManager ( Core c, Microsoft.Xna.Framework.Game g, BallGenerator gen ) : System
BlackWhite ( ) : void
Color ( ) : void
Draw ( GameTime gameTime ) : void
Initialise ( ) : void
LoadBallGraphicsContent ( ) : void
LoadGraphicsContent ( SpriteBatch spriteBatch ) : void
LoadGraphicsContent ( SpriteBatch spriteBatch, Microsoft.Xna.Framework.Graphics.Texture2D texture ) : void
ResetColour ( ) : void
StartPosition ( ) : Vector2
Update ( GameTime gameTime ) : void

메소드 상세

BallManager() 공개 메소드

public BallManager ( Core c ) : System
c TuneBlaster_.Graphics.Core
리턴 System

BallManager() 공개 메소드

public BallManager ( Core c, Microsoft.Xna.Framework.Game g ) : System
c TuneBlaster_.Graphics.Core
g Microsoft.Xna.Framework.Game
리턴 System

BallManager() 공개 메소드

public BallManager ( Core c, Microsoft.Xna.Framework.Game g, BallGenerator gen ) : System
c TuneBlaster_.Graphics.Core
g Microsoft.Xna.Framework.Game
gen BallGenerator
리턴 System

BlackWhite() 공개 메소드

public BlackWhite ( ) : void
리턴 void

Color() 공개 메소드

public Color ( ) : void
리턴 void

Draw() 공개 메소드

public Draw ( GameTime gameTime ) : void
gameTime Microsoft.Xna.Framework.GameTime
리턴 void

Initialise() 공개 메소드

public Initialise ( ) : void
리턴 void

LoadBallGraphicsContent() 공개 메소드

public LoadBallGraphicsContent ( ) : void
리턴 void

LoadGraphicsContent() 공개 메소드

public LoadGraphicsContent ( SpriteBatch spriteBatch ) : void
spriteBatch Microsoft.Xna.Framework.Graphics.SpriteBatch
리턴 void

LoadGraphicsContent() 공개 메소드

public LoadGraphicsContent ( SpriteBatch spriteBatch, Microsoft.Xna.Framework.Graphics.Texture2D texture ) : void
spriteBatch Microsoft.Xna.Framework.Graphics.SpriteBatch
texture Microsoft.Xna.Framework.Graphics.Texture2D
리턴 void

ResetColour() 공개 메소드

public ResetColour ( ) : void
리턴 void

StartPosition() 공개 메소드

public StartPosition ( ) : Vector2
리턴 Vector2

Update() 공개 메소드

public Update ( GameTime gameTime ) : void
gameTime Microsoft.Xna.Framework.GameTime
리턴 void

프로퍼티 상세

green 공개적으로 프로퍼티

public Texture2D,Microsoft.Xna.Framework.Graphics green
리턴 Microsoft.Xna.Framework.Graphics.Texture2D